内容主体大纲:1. 引言 - 数字资产管理的重要性 - 小狐钱包的背景和发展2. 小狐钱包5.6.1新特性 - 界面 - 安全性提升...
区块链是一种分布式数据库技术,它通过去中心化的方式,将数据以“区块”的形式按时间顺序串联起来,形成一个不可篡改的“链”。每个区块中包含了一系列的交易信息和一个前区块的哈希值,从而确保了数据的安全性和完整性。
#### 区块链的历史发展区块链技术最早在2008年由中本聪在比特币白皮书中提出,作为支撑比特币这一加密货币的核心技术。随后,区块链技术得到了广泛的关注,随着以太坊等平台的兴起,区块链的应用逐渐扩展到金融、供应链、医疗等多个领域。
#### 关键特性:去中心化、透明性、安全性区块链最大的特点是“去中心化”,意味着不再依赖单一的管理机构来掌控数据。在透明性方面,所有交易都公开可见,任何人都能通过节点参与验证。而安全性则通过加密技术和共识机制保障,使得数据难以被篡改。
### 2. 区块链的工作原理 #### 区块的组成部分每个区块由三部分组成:区块头、区块体和哈希值。区块头包含了前一个区块的哈希值、当前区块的时间戳、Nonce值(用于挖矿的随机数),而区块体则包裹着实际的交易数据。
#### 数据如何被记录和验证区块链的数据记录过程一般包括:用户发起交易,交易信息被广播到网络,节点对交易进行验证,然后将合法交易打包成区块。经过共识机制达成共识后,区块被添加到链中。
#### 共识机制(工作量证明、权益证明等)共识机制是区块链确保数据一致性的重要手段。最常见的工作量证明(PoW)要求矿工通过计算来证明其工作量,而权益证明(PoS)则通过持有代币的数量和时间来决定创建新区块的权利。
### 3. 区块链的应用场景 #### 加密货币的基础区块链技术最初用于加密货币,比特币作为第一个应用使得区块链技术广为人知。其他如以太坊、Ripple等也在不断推动数字资产的普及。
#### 金融行业的区块链应用在金融行业,区块链技术可用于跨境支付、智能合约以及资产证券化等方面。它减少了中介环节,提高了交易效率与透明度。
#### 供应链管理中的区块链区块链在供应链管理中可以追踪产品的来源和流动,确保食品安全和物流透明。通过参与各方共享信息,提高了供应链的效率和信任度。
#### 政府及公共服务领域的应用一些政府机构也在探索区块链应用,如电子投票、身份认证及公证服务,以提高政府透明度和降低腐败。
#### 物联网与区块链的结合物联网设备生成大量数据,区块链能够为这些数据提供安全保障,促进设备间的自动化交易和协作。
### 4. 区块链面临的挑战与解决方案 #### 可扩展性问题随着用户的增多,区块链网络的拥堵问题日益严重。解决方案包括分层技术、分区链(sharding)等,以提高交易处理速度。
#### 能源消耗与环境影响工作量证明机制的高能耗引发了环境问题。许多项目开始探索更为环保的共识机制,如权益证明,以减少能源消耗。
#### 法律与监管问题区块链的去中心化特性使其在法律监管上存在困难。各国政府可以制定相应的法律法规,以保护用户权益,同时扶持技术门槛的创新。
#### 安全性与隐私保护虽然区块链本身具备安全性,但智能合约的漏洞、私钥管理不善等依然可能引发安全问题。因此,开发者应重视安全性及隐私保护的设计。
### 5. 未来区块链技术的发展趋势 #### 新兴技术与区块链的结合未来更多新兴技术如量子计算、人工智能等将与区块链结合,推动其发展和应用。
#### 数字身份与智能合约的发展数字身份技术的发展将使得用户在区块链上的身份管理更加安全便捷,而智能合约的普及则将提高各类交易的自动化水平。
#### 社会经济的变革与区块链区块链将推动社会经济的变革,尤其是在财务、投票、供应链透明度等方面,促进商业模式的创新。
### 6. 常见问题解答 #### 区块链是否会替代传统金融系统?虽然区块链提供了许多优于传统金融系统的优势,如去中心化、透明性和快速交易,但要完全替代传统金融系统仍需要时间。金融机构大多在尝试融合区块链,因此未来的趋势可能是两者的结合,而不是简单的替代。
区块链在数据完整性及不可篡改性方面有显著优势,能够减少一些信息安全问题的发生。然而,区块链并不能完全解决所有安全问题,例如用户私钥的管理依然是一个薄弱环节。
去中心化意味着企业可以减少对第三方机构的依赖,从而降低成本。但同时,它也要求企业在自身的技术能力和治理结构上进行调整,以应对新的风险和挑战。
选择区块链平台需要根据项目需求考虑,如性能、可扩展性、安全性及开发者社区的支持等。此外,是否需要支持智能合约或其他特性也应纳入评估范围。
区块链为小企业提供了新的商业模式和融资渠道。在供应链管理、支付系统等领域,小企业可借助区块链技术提升效率和透明度。然而,小企业在技术实施上需要一定的投资和学习成本。
人工智能与区块链的结合能为大数据的处理与存储提供保障。区块链可以确保数据的真实性,而人工智能则可以通过分析这些数据,为决策提供依据。这种结合将推动许多行业的发展,尤其是金融和健康医疗等领域。
以上是对区块链技术的详尽介绍和常见问题的解答。通过理解这些基础知识,可以帮助读者更好地把握区块链在现代社会中的重要性和未来发展趋势。